Step-by-step explanation:

There are a number of ways angles can be identified as congruent. In each case, the converse of the proposition is also true.

  • opposite angles of a parallelogram are congruent
  • corresponding angles where a transversal crosses parallel lines are congruent
  • alternate interior angles where a transversal crosses parallel lines are congruent
  • vertical angles are congruent
  • any two angles with the same measure are congruent

In these exercises, pairs of angles need to be examined to see which of these relations may apply.

_____

<em>Additional comment</em>

The question asks you to list pairs of congruent angles. When 3 things are congruent, they can be arranged in 3 pairs:

  a ≅ b ≅ c   ⇒   (a≅b), (a≅c), (b≅c)

Similarly, when 4 things are congruent, they can be arranged in 6 pairs:

  a ≅ b ≅ c ≅ d   ⇒   (a≅b), (a≅c), (a≅d), (b≅c), (b≅d), (c≅d)

In the above, we have elected not to list all of the pairs, but to list the set of congruences from which pairs can be chosen.

the ratio of boys to girls are 8 to 7. if there was a total of 195 students, how many boys and girls are there?
Misha Larkins [42]
Add the values of the ratio.

8+7= 15

Boys: 195/15= 13(8)=104

Girls: 195/15= 13(7)= 91

There are 104 boys and 91 girls. Hope this helps!
